As one of the country’s largest universities in terms of student numbers and physical infrastructure,  UiTM has certainly come of age since its humble beginnings in 1956 when it started as RIDA [Rural & Industrial Development Authority] Training Centre, and inspired by Dato’ Onn Jaafar with only 50 students. Fast forward to the present and this project is one of UiTM’s 33 campus locations nationwide offering up to 500 programmes from foundation to doctorate levels for some 180,000 students.


 


The Tapah site provided us with 1,100 acres of undulating Kinta silica sandy terrain about 8 km west of Tapah town. From the brief to accommodate academic facilities for 5,000 students, with 50% full-board student housing, we only needed to carve 76 acres for phase 1 of this satellite university of UiTM.
